Context
In this hadith, a young boy named An-Nu`man bin Bashir is taken by his father to the Prophet Muhammad (ﷺ) to witness a gift that the father has given him. The mother insists on the Prophet's (ﷺ) witness to ensure fairness, as the father has other sons. The Prophet (ﷺ) responds by emphasizing the importance of justice, stating that he will not be a witness to injustice, highlighting the need for equitable treatment among children.
Modern Application
This hadith reminds us of the importance of fairness in family dynamics, especially in matters of inheritance and gifts. Parents today can reflect on this principle by ensuring that all children feel equally valued and treated justly, fostering a sense of equity and harmony within the family.
